Planning Your Visit

A Modern Marvel, Now a Ghost of Governance

This striking, futuristic building was once the Parliament of Georgia. Now, it stands largely empty, awaiting its next chapter as a tech hub. While you can't enter, its unique architecture is a sight to behold from the outside. Be aware that surrounding areas might be under construction, impacting accessibility.

Photography and Access

While the building's unique glass and steel dome is a photographer's dream, access can be tricky. Some visitors report being told not to take pictures by security, while others have had no issues from the street. Patience and a respectful approach might be key to capturing this architectural gem.

🎫 💡 About the Building

Built between 2011 and 2012 under President Mikheil Saakashvili, it was intended to decentralize government from Tbilisi. However, parliamentary functions returned to Tbilisi in 2019. Reddit

The building features a striking, futuristic design with an oval glass and steel dome, designed by Japanese architects Mamoru Kawaguchi and Kenichi Kawaguchi. Reddit

The building is no longer used as a parliament. Plans are underway to transform it into the Kutaisi Tech Hub, focusing on IT and technology education and research. Reddit

It's considered strange because it's a relatively new, architecturally significant building that is no longer serving its original purpose, leading to a sense of underutilization. Reddit
